MINING.

The Waihi Grand Junction Gold Company during the period ended September 4 crushed 6100 tons oi ore for a return of £i) 172 15s Ud. Compared with the return lor the corresponding period of last year, when 3190 tons were treated for a return ot £1627, this shows an increase of £4545 15s 3d. The total amount won from tho miao to date is £1,010,05110 a od.
